Finishing a mainstay like Stefan Struve in such emphatic fashion would give any UFC heavyweight a tremendous shot in the arm, especially a prospering contender like New Zealander Mark Hunt.

With his highlight-reel knockout of Struve at UFC on Fuel TV 8, Hunt not only earned his way into the promotion’s official top 10 heavyweight rankings (No.9) for the first time, he also stretched his winning streak to a division-best four straight victories.

Hunt, a man who lost his sixth straight fight in his promotional debut at UFC 119 in 2010, has pocketed a pair of “Knockout of the Night” bonuses in two of his last four fights, gaining a reputation as the division’s most captivating fighter along the way.

Since every fighter’s only as valuable as his or her last fight in the UFC, Hunt must have certainly punched his ticket for a main-event bout in his next outing by breaking Struve’s jaw.

Here’s a peek at five possible fights for “The Super Samoan” to take next.
